Compiles LLVM Intermediate Representation or bitcode to target-specific assembly language. More information: <https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://www.llvm.org/docs/CommandGuide/llc.html>.
-
Compile a bitcode or IR file to an assembly file with the same base name:
llc path/to/file.ll -
Enable all optimizations:
llc -O3 path/to/input.ll -
Output assembly to a specific file:
llc --output path/to/output.s -
Emit fully relocatable, position independent code:
llc -relocation-model=pic path/to/input.ll
